Delete a list and all its cards
AI agents call planka_delete_list to permanently remove resources in Planka MCP Server for Claude — typically in cleanup and lifecycle workflows. It does its job in a single call, and there is no undo.
This tool permanently deletes a list and all associated cards without reversal. Destructive operations have higher severity than Write or Execute because the data loss cannot be undone. In a project management context, an AI misuse could wipe out entire task lists and their contents.
From the tool's definition Tool name includes 'delete_list' and description explicitly states 'Delete a list and all its cards' — irreversible removal of data.

planka_delete_list is a Destructive tool with critical risk. Critical-risk tools should be blocked by default and only enabled with explicit human approval.
Yes. Add a rate_limit block to the planka_delete_list rule in your PolicyLayer policy. For example, setting max: 10 and window: 60 limits the tool to 10 calls per minute. Rate limits are tracked per agent session and reset automatically.
Set action: deny in the PolicyLayer policy for planka_delete_list. The AI agent will receive a policy violation error and cannot call the tool. You can also include a reason field to explain why the tool is blocked.
planka_delete_list is provided by the Planka MCP Server for Claude MCP server (nextheberg/planka-mcp-server-for-claude). PolicyLayer sits as a proxy in front of this server to enforce policies before tool calls reach the server.
